The music lover's dream

Soundville Studios, Lucerne, Switzerland. The passionate studio owner and main engineer asked for the evaluation of the JMF Audio power amplification technology for the control room in 1988 (the isolated room in which the sound engineer and the producer make the technical choices and monitor the overall sound result). A never experienced natural sound filled the space… Tom Hidley, the American designer of the studio, was advised to come and listen. Seduced, he then challenged Jean-Marie Fusilier...

Nashville, USA, the music city, 1989. The largest studio complex, designed by Tom Hidley, was the place where critical measurements and sound quality tests of the purpose designed JMF Audio mono amplifiers had to take place. Evaluations were carried on by focused engineers… Jean Marie Fusilier's creation was declared more transparent, accurate, natural sounding, simply faithful… The studios owner and GRAMMY Awards winner instantly acquired two pairs of mono amplifiers. The reputation of the studios had to be preserved.

Starting from the results in Nashville, Tom Hidley has advised JMF Audio's power amplifiers which ideally complemented his unique approach to simple path, neutral and faithful sound monitoring:      

Masterfonics, Mix Room, USA, with the JMF Audio designed power amplifiers was awarded best control room of the USA in 1998 by professional magazine Mix. Notable hits have been produced at Masterfonics by Shania Twain, Willie Nelson, Céline Dion... The JMF Audio power amplifiers have been selected by recording studios from London to Moscow, through Capri in Italy... and by music lovers, mostly in France and Asia.

JMF Audio has continued the developments for the professionals and the audio enthusiasts who put music first. 

Miscendo Studios, Paris, France 2015, for the multi platinum sound engineer and owner who formerly operated at Larabee Studios, Los Angeles, USA, and Studios de la Grande Armée, Paris (the studio with the most prestigious pedigree in France), JMF Audio delivered HQS 9001 mono power amplifiers, power cords, cables, custom monitors and took in charge the integration... 

Lindberg Lyd (2L), Norway, 2016 (classical music and jazz). With 28 nominations for the GRAMMY Awards with respect to the excellence of his work, the producer and owner Morten Lindberg integrated the JMF Audio's PCD302 mains filter and power cords to supply the recording equipment in the pursuit of the most natural sounding albums. 2L was pioneer in very high definition audio production. Jan Gunnar Hoff, Stories (piano solo jazz recorded in a church) was the first Blu-ray Pure Audio album ever recorded using JMF Audio's technology. This time the contribution of JMF Audio on the sound was direct and engraved on the disc, for the enjoyment of all music lovers on all systems (hybrid SACD also included)…

Heritage   -  the recording studios

Tom Hidley was a musician who built his own studio in Hollywood (named TTG) and produced the music of artists such as Frank Zappa, Coleman Hawkins, Johnny Hodges, Roy Eldridge, Peggy Lee… for labels such as Verve. Adviser for Frank Sinatra, he eventually became the most influential and respected recording studio designer. His numerous designs, including for Westlake Recording and Record Plant, have housed productions of major artists such as Jimi Hendrix, Stevie Wonder, Michael Jackson, Phil Collins, Shania Twain, Céline Dion, The London Symphonic Orchestra...

Composer Michel Magne's studio in the Chateau d’Hérouville, marked the start in Europe with enthusiastic Elton John about Hidley's contribution during the sessions for "Don't shoot me, I am only the piano player", as documented by journalist Frank Ernould. Most major studios in France were later designed (Studios de la Grande Armée, Davout, Les Dames, Delphine, Ferber, Marcadet, Guillaume Tell, Polygone, Plateforme, AB...).

Tom Hidley developed the “non-environmental” room acoustics for faithful sound quality monitoring. In 1988, he found in JMF Audio's amplifiers the natural sound and high output power that perfectly matched the concept.

Recording studios featuring JMF Audio's power amplifiers such as Masterfonics (Nashville) and Nomis (London) are used as examples and illustrations in Philip Newell's book "Recording studio design".

Pure Audio and GRAMMY Awards

Pure Audio Blu-ray is the latest high definition audio-only disc format that outperforms CD and SACD (Super Audio CD). 2L of Norway, the MSM studios of Germany and JMF Audio of France are the pioneers on Pure Audio Blu-ray, respectively for recording/producing, authoring/development and playback.

The London Symphony Orchestra (LSO), The Berliner Philharmoniker have moved to Pure Audio Blu-ray production.

Universal Music has also taken advantage of the Blu-ray since 2013 with releases as High Fidelity Pure Audio for Verve, Blue Note, DECCA, Deutsche Grammophon, A&M, Motown... (new releases as well as remasterings of legendary albums, such as Beethoven the 9 Symphonies with Karajan in 2014, now on a single disc).

Numerous works released on Blu-ray Pure Audio have been nominated for the GRAMMY Awards (more than 30 nominations of 2L only), with several wins (Patricia Barber, Gregory Porter, Roger Waters...). Major Grammy Awards winners produce Blu-ray Pure Audio discs, such as Jim Anderson (Avatar Studios, Skywalker Sound), Darcy Proper (Wisseloord Studios), Sono Luminus (official studio for Steinway & Sons' artists).
